波峰提取技术:从实验波数据中提取峰值
版权申诉
20 浏览量
更新于2024-11-03
收藏 1KB ZIP 举报
在科学研究和工程技术领域,波峰提取是一项常见的数据处理任务,尤其在信号处理、图像分析、地质勘探和生物医学工程等领域具有广泛的应用。波峰提取技术的目的是从一系列波形数据中准确找出波峰的位置,这些波峰通常代表了信号的重要特征,如频率、强度和时间周期等。本资源中提到的"bofengTQ.zip"是一个包含峰值提取功能的压缩文件,其核心功能为从波形数据中提取出波峰,这对后续的数据分析和处理至关重要。
峰值提取可以采取不同的方法,常见的包括但不限于以下几种:
1. 一阶导数法:通过计算波形数据的一阶导数,找出导数为零的点,这些点对应原波形的极值点(极大值或极小值),再结合二阶导数或曲率信息来判断这些极值点是否为波峰。这种方法对噪声较为敏感,可能需要对信号进行平滑处理。
2. 阈值法:设定一个阈值,当波形数据超过这个阈值时,可以认为该点是波峰。这种方法简单易行,但需要根据实际情况调整阈值以获得最佳效果。
3. 高斯拟合法:如果波形数据可以近似用高斯函数描述,那么可以使用高斯拟合方法来估计波峰的位置。这种方法在高斯噪声背景下能够较好地提取波峰。
4. 算法方法:如极值搜索、区域增长、形态学操作等,这些都是基于图像处理和模式识别算法来提取波峰的技术。
波峰提取的应用场景非常广泛,例如:
- 在地震数据处理中,提取地震波的波峰有助于地质学家分析地层结构和寻找矿产资源。
- 在心电图(ECG)分析中,波峰的提取可以用于诊断心脏病。
- 在光纤通信中,波峰位置可以作为载波频率,用于提高数据传输速率和准确性。
- 在声学分析中,提取声波的波峰有助于语音识别和噪声控制。
了解和掌握波峰提取技术,对于进行精确的数据分析具有重要的现实意义。不同的应用场景可能需要不同的提取方法和参数设置,因此,专业人员通常需要结合具体问题和数据特点来选择最合适的技术方案。
在使用"bofengTQ.zip"这类峰值提取工具时,用户可能需要进行以下步骤:
- 准备波形数据:将实验或测量得到的波形数据导入到工具中。
- 参数设置:根据数据的特性和提取要求,调整峰值提取算法的相关参数。
- 提取波峰:运行峰值提取算法,获取波峰位置及相关特征。
- 结果分析:对提取结果进行分析,这可能包括波峰的统计分析、波峰与波谷的比较等。
- 结果应用:将提取得到的波峰信息应用于进一步的研究或工程实践中。
峰值提取技术的不断进步,正不断推动着相关学科的研究深度和广度,有助于科研人员和工程师更精确、高效地处理和分析波形数据。
1448 浏览量
591 浏览量
201 浏览量
183 浏览量
125 浏览量
2022-09-15 上传
2021-08-09 上传
2021-08-09 上传

朱moyimi
- 粉丝: 88
最新资源
- 初学者入门必备!Visual C++开发的连连看小程序
- C#实现SqlServer分页存储过程示例分析
- 西门子工业网络通信例程解读与实践
- JavaScript实现表格变色与选中效果指南
- MVP与Retrofit2.0相结合的登录示例教程
- MFC实现透明泡泡效果与文件操作教程
- 探索Delphi ERP框架的核心功能与应用案例
- 爱尔兰COVID-19案例数据分析与可视化
- 提升效率的三维石头制作插件
- 人脸C++识别系统实现:源码与测试包
- MishMash Hackathon:Python编程马拉松盛事
- JavaScript Switch语句练习指南:简洁注释详解
- C语言实现的通讯录管理系统设计教程
- ASP.net实现用户登录注册功能模块详解
- 吉时利2000数据读取与分析教程
- 钻石画软件:从设计到生产的高效解决方案